A recent Picasso inspired cubism works made with oil paint, acrylic and chalk. I made this painting in a sort of experimentation. 
A few years back at a Gallery opening in New York City, a fellow artist mentioned to me about applying acrylic and oil paint on the same canvas. It was an interesting concept. 
In this work I started off with acrylic black lines, which is pretty usual for me. Then I used chalk as a rub for texture and a few scribbles with oil pastels. This is to set an underlying tone. I used cadmium red, orange and yellow to paint the cubism figure. The background I painted with cerulean and white mix with a broad brush. Lastly , I used a palette knife to make circular patterns over the wet paint.
